深圳121家企业成立10年内上市
21世纪经济报道· 2025-11-18 04:08
Core Viewpoint - Shenzhen has successfully nurtured 121 companies to go public within ten years, showcasing a robust innovation ecosystem that supports rapid growth in technology enterprises [1][3]. Group 1: Companies Achieving Rapid Growth - Among the 121 companies, 87 are listed on A-shares and 34 on Hong Kong stocks, indicating a strong performance in capital markets [1]. - Companies like Zhongke Feicai and Laplace have achieved significant milestones in the semiconductor sector, with Zhongke Feicai going public in just 8 years and becoming a key player in semiconductor quality control [3][4]. - In the smart hardware sector, companies such as Yingshi Innovation have redefined global consumer markets, with Yingshi becoming the global leader in panoramic cameras with a market share of 67.2% [4]. Group 2: Emerging Sectors and Innovations - The renewable energy sector is also thriving, with companies like Youyou Green Energy focusing on high-efficiency charging equipment for electric vehicles, contributing to the rapid development of the charging infrastructure [5]. - Shenzhen's companies are not only innovating in technology but also collectively enhancing the city's industrial structure towards high-tech and globally competitive sectors [5]. Group 3: Supportive Ecosystem for Startups - Shenzhen has established a comprehensive enterprise cultivation system, including various incubators and funding mechanisms, to support startups and scale-ups [7][8]. - The city has set up government investment funds that have mobilized nearly 500 billion yuan to support over 8,000 industry projects, resulting in a significant number of companies becoming specialized and innovative [8][9]. - The average time for startups to go public in Shenzhen is 13.35 years, which is faster than the national average, reflecting the city's efficient support for innovation and growth [9].

优优绿能今日申购 顶格申购需配市值2.5万元
Group 1 - The company, Youyou Green Energy, has initiated its subscription process, offering a total of 10.50 million shares, with 2.52 million shares available for online subscription at a price of 89.60 yuan per share and a price-earnings ratio of 15.37 times [1] - The company specializes in the research, production, and sales of core components for direct current charging equipment for electric vehicles and is recognized as a national high-tech enterprise [1] - The funds raised will be allocated to the construction of a charging module production base and a headquarters and R&D center, with investments of 270 million yuan each, and an additional 160 million yuan for working capital [1] Group 2 - Key financial indicators for the company show total assets of 17.97 billion yuan in 2024, up from 14.18 billion yuan in 2023 and 10.12 billion yuan in 2022 [2] - The company's net profit for 2024 is reported at 2.56 billion yuan, slightly down from 2.68 billion yuan in 2023, while operating revenue increased to 14.97 billion yuan from 13.76 billion yuan in the previous year [2] - The weighted return on equity decreased to 28.64% in 2024 from 42.03% in 2023, indicating a decline in profitability relative to equity [2]
